diff options
author | Joram Wilander <jwawilander@gmail.com> | 2016-11-03 10:41:11 -0400 |
---|---|---|
committer | Christopher Speller <crspeller@gmail.com> | 2016-11-03 10:41:11 -0400 |
commit | 0234f793f29a90572d2288b7b22b75cd5ab83648 (patch) | |
tree | 76f67d1be0756c9186973f4db27a77643efcdfeb /webapp/client/client.jsx | |
parent | 5b34ac6e1e4d24f51c754926305149b7986f38c4 (diff) | |
download | chat-0234f793f29a90572d2288b7b22b75cd5ab83648.tar.gz chat-0234f793f29a90572d2288b7b22b75cd5ab83648.tar.bz2 chat-0234f793f29a90572d2288b7b22b75cd5ab83648.zip |
EE: PLT-4512 Show secret in addition to QR code when activating MFA (#4427)
* EE: Update MFA to display secret for manual entry
* Width adjustments for secret (#4423)
* Add unit test
Diffstat (limited to 'webapp/client/client.jsx')
-rw-r--r-- | webapp/client/client.jsx | 9 |
1 files changed, 9 insertions, 0 deletions
diff --git a/webapp/client/client.jsx b/webapp/client/client.jsx index fd091fd69..a615bd501 100644 --- a/webapp/client/client.jsx +++ b/webapp/client/client.jsx @@ -990,6 +990,15 @@ export default class Client { this.track('api', 'api_users_oauth_to_email'); } + generateMfaSecret(success, error) { + request. + get(`${this.getUsersRoute()}/generate_mfa_secret`). + set(this.defaultHeaders). + type('application/json'). + accept('application/json'). + end(this.handleResponse.bind(this, 'generateMfaSecret', success, error)); + } + revokeSession(altId, success, error) { request. post(`${this.getUsersRoute()}/revoke_session`). |